Takafumi Hasegawa practices in Sendai, Japan. Hasegawa is rated as an Advanced expert by MediFind in the treatment of Progressive Supranuclear Palsy Atypical. Their top areas of expertise are Parkinson's Disease, Movement Disorders, Corticobasal Degeneration, and Progressive Supranuclear Palsy.
Their clinical research consists of co-authoring 73 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years. In particular, they have co-authored 7 articles in the study of Progressive Supranuclear Palsy Atypical.

Clinical Research
Clinical research consists of overseeing clinical studies of patients undergoing new treatments and therapies, and publishing articles in peer reviewed medical journals. Experts who actively participate in clinical research are generally at the forefront of the fields and aware of the most up-to-date advances in treatments for their patients.
